3. Campaign Contribution Information and Public Reporting
If you make a campaign contribution, Florida law may require the campaign to collect and report certain contributor information, including your name, address, contribution amount, contribution date, and occupation or principal type of business when required.
Campaign finance reports may become public records and may be made available through the appropriate election authority or public campaign finance database. The campaign cannot guarantee that information required to be reported under campaign finance law will remain private.
The campaign may also be required to retain contribution and expenditure records for legal compliance, audit, reporting, and recordkeeping purposes.
